The Traffic Director for London, in accordance with a direction given to him by the Secretary of State under section 58(1) of the Road Traffic Act 1991(1) and in exercise of the powers conferred on the Secretary of State by section 6 of the Road Traffic Regulation Act 1984(2), and of all other enabling powers, hereby makes the following Order:-
1. This Order may be cited as the A316 Trunk Road (Richmond) Red Route Traffic Order 1997 Variation Order 2000 and shall come into force on 10th May 2000.
2. The A316 Trunk Road (Richmond) Red Route Traffic Order 1997(3) is varied by the following provisions of this Order.
3. In schedule 2A items 9 and 10 are deleted.
4. In schedule 2B items 9 and 10 are substituted as follows:
"9. | Between a point 14 metres south-west of the north-eastern wall of 57 Bicester Road and a point 23 metres south-west of that point. | At Any time | None | None |
10. | Between a point opposite the party wall of 263 and 265 Lower Richmond Road and a point 22 metres north-east of that point." |
5. In schedule 3B item 7 is substituted as follows:
"7. | Between a point 4 metres south-west of the north-eastern wall of 57 Bicester Road and a point 10 metres south-west of that point. | 7am-7pm Monday-Saturday Inclusive" |
